linux脚本命令修改
-
修改Linux脚本命令有多种方法,下面是一些常见的修改方式:
1. 使用文本编辑器修改脚本文件:可以使用vim、nano等文本编辑器打开脚本文件,找到需要修改的命令行,直接修改保存即可。
2. 使用sed命令批量修改脚本文件:sed是一款流式文本编辑器,可以在命令行中使用。例如,如果要将脚本中的所有”abc”替换为”xyz”,可以运行如下命令:
“`
sed -i ‘s/abc/xyz/g’ script.sh
“`上述命令会将script.sh文件中所有的”abc”替换为”xyz”,-i选项表示直接修改源文件。
3. 使用awk命令修改脚本文件:awk是一种处理文本的强大工具,可以运行在命令行中。如果要修改脚本文件中的特定行或特定字段,可以使用awk命令。例如,如果要将第3行的第2个字段替换为”xyz”,可以运行如下命令:
“`
awk ‘NR==3 { $2=”xyz” } 1’ script.sh > temp.sh && mv temp.sh script.sh
“`上述命令将会修改script.sh中第3行的第2个字段,并将结果保存到temp.sh文件中,然后再将temp.sh文件重命名为script.sh。
4. 使用shell脚本编写修改脚本:如果需要进行复杂的修改操作,可以编写一个shell脚本来实现修改。在脚本中,可以使用各种条件判断、循环等命令来实现需要的修改逻辑。
以上是几种常见的Linux脚本命令修改方法,根据不同的需求可以选择适合的方法进行修改。
2年前 -
1. 使用文本编辑器创建脚本文件:您可以使用任何文本编辑器(如vi、nano等)在Linux系统上创建脚本文件。按照脚本命令的语法编写脚本内容,确保每个命令都是新的一行。
2. 修改脚本文件的权限:在使用脚本之前,需要确保脚本文件具有可执行权限。可以使用chmod命令添加可执行权限。例如,使用以下命令添加可执行权限:
“`shell
chmod +x script.sh
“`这将允许您运行名为script.sh的脚本文件。
3. 修改脚本文件的扩展名:虽然在Linux中没有必要使用特定的文件扩展名来标识脚本文件,但为了方便识别,可以将脚本文件的扩展名命名为.sh。这只是一种约定,不是强制要求。
4. 在脚本文件中添加注释:为了提高脚本的可读性和可维护性,建议在脚本文件中添加注释。注释可以帮助其他人理解脚本的用途和工作方式。在bash脚本中,使用“#”符号来添加注释。例如:
“`shell
# This is a comment
“`5. 测试和调试脚本命令:在修改脚本命令之前,建议先进行测试和调试。可以使用echo命令在终端中输出脚本命令的执行结果,以确保脚本按预期方式工作。例如:
“`shell
echo “Hello, World!”
“`这将在终端中打印出”Hello, World!”。通过检查输出结果,可以验证脚本命令是否按照预期工作。
以上是关于如何修改Linux脚本命令的一些基本方法和建议。根据实际需求和具体情况,您可能还需要进行更多的修改和优化。
2年前 -
Linux脚本命令的修改指的是对已有的脚本进行编辑和调整,以满足特定的需求。在Linux系统中,可以使用任何文本编辑器修改脚本命令,比如vi、nano、gedit等。下面将介绍修改Linux脚本命令的一般流程和步骤。
1. 选择合适的文本编辑器:Linux系统中有许多文本编辑器可供选择。vi是一个强大的文本编辑器,虽然它的操作相对复杂,但它的功能非常齐全。Nano和gedit则是更加简单易用的编辑器,适合初学者使用。
2. 打开脚本文件:使用选择的文本编辑器打开需要修改的脚本文件。可以使用命令行的方式打开,如`vi script.sh`,或者使用图形化界面打开。
3. 阅读和分析脚本:在开始修改之前,首先需要仔细阅读和分析脚本的功能和结构。了解脚本的作用以及各个部分的逻辑关系对于修改是非常重要的。
4. 修改脚本:根据需要对脚本进行修改。修改的内容通常包括变量的赋值、函数的调用、命令的执行等。具体的修改内容取决于脚本的功能和需求。
5. 测试修改后的脚本:在对脚本进行修改之后,需要进行测试以确保修改的正确和有效。可以通过执行脚本来进行测试,并检查输出结果和执行是否符合预期。
6. 保存修改:在修改完成并通过测试后,需要保存修改后的脚本文件。使用文本编辑器的保存命令将修改保存到脚本文件中。
7. 执行脚本:修改完成并保存后,可以使用原来的方式来执行脚本,以验证修改是否能够达到预期的效果。
需要注意的是,在修改脚本命令时,应当谨慎操作,并备份原始脚本文件。修改时应逐行检查和确认,以免引入错误或破坏原来的功能。另外,应当遵循脚本命令的基本规范和最佳实践,以便脚本的维护和扩展。
2年前